This week, I speak with my good friend Owen O'Kane for a second time on Slo Mo. (Check out episode 120 for our first chat if you missed it). Owen is a psychotherapist and author of Ten Times Happier and the globally acclaimed and Sunday Times bestselling book, Ten to Zen..
His latest book, How to Be Your Own Therapist, is out on June 23rd.
Owen has over 25 years’ experience in physical and mental health and is a former NHS Mental Health Clinical Lead. He now runs a successful private practice in London.
Listen as we discuss:
- The healing power and intuition of dogs.
- Combating the stigma and hurdles of getting therapy.
- Owen's new book, How to Be Your Own Therapist, and writing himself out of a job.
- Getting attached to the familiarity of your own issues.
- Learning to attribute our problems to how we approach life, not on external factors.
- The importance of understanding your story.
- Owen's shame as a young gay man was his brain feeding him inaccurate information.
- The pressure to be happy all the time when you're a "happiness teacher."
- All you need to do is be truthful.
- PPSD, or post-pandemic stress order.
- What's one thing you can do immediately to make life happier?
